Point K is on line JL. given JL =4x, JK= 2x+3, and KL=x, determine the numerical length of kl​
balandron [24]

Hi! I'm happy to help!

Our total line is JL (4x), and it is split into two parts: JK, and KL. We have our values, and we know that JK+KL=JL, so we can substitute our values and solve for x:

4x=(2x+3)+(x)

4x=3x+3

To solve for x, we have to isolate it on one side of the equation.

First, let's subtract 3x from both sides so that we can isolate x:

4x=3x+3

-3x -3x

x=3

<u>So, our x=3, which means that KL=3.</u>

two runners start 30kilometer apart and run toward each other. they meet after 3hours. One Runner runs 2 kilometers per hour fas
belka [17]

Let the slower runners speed be X kilometers per hour.

Then the faster runners speed would be X+2 kilometers per hour.


The formula for distance is Speed times time.

The distance is given as 30 kilometers and time is given as 3 hours.


Since there are two runners you need to add the both of them together.

The equation becomes 30 = 3x + 3(x+2)

Now solve for x:

30 = 3x + 3(x+2)

Simplify:

30 = 3x + 3x +6

30 = 6x + 6

Subtract 6 from each side:

24 = 6x

Divide both sides by 6:

x = 24/6

x = 4


The slower runner ran at 4 kilometers per hour.

The faster runner ran at 4+2 = 6 kilometers per hour.
